[QUOTE="SbassLaser, post: 8860184, member: 686280"] The general rule of thumb that I've always been told is 100ah of AGM for every 1000 watts you want to run, but I went straight to lithium so I don't have personal experience with lead batteries. I believe there's a calculator on the ultimate car audio app that can tell you how much battery capacity you need, but I've also never used that. I would personally recommend a small lithium bank, a 56 ah headway bank would be good for 3kw and definitely cheaper than buying 300 ah of AGMs, but I know some people prefer to stick with lead.
